Kimal is seeking a Key Account Manager – Procedural Solutions to drive sales growth and expand market presence across the UK. This field-based role requires experience in medical devices with strong relationship-building skills.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Developing new business opportunities
  • Managing key accounts within NHS and private healthcare

The ideal candidate should have:

  • A relevant degree
  • 2–3 years of medical sales experience
  • Excellent communication skills

Benefits include:

  • Car allowance
  • Performance-based bonuses
  • 25 days annual leave

How to prepare for a job interview at Kimal

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of medical devices and the procedural solutions Kimal offers. Familiarise yourself with their products and how they fit into the NHS and private healthcare sectors. This will show that you're genuinely interested and prepared.

✨Build Rapport

Since this role is all about relationship-building, practice your interpersonal skills. Think of ways to connect with your interviewers, perhaps by discussing shared interests or experiences in the medical field. A friendly, approachable attitude can go a long way!

✨Showcase Your Achievements

Prepare specific examples from your past experience that highlight your success in driving sales growth and managing key accounts.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ses and make them impactful.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ready about Kimal's future plans or challenges in the market. This not only shows your interest but also gives you a chance to demonstrate your strategic thinking and understanding of the industry.
